Overview
The shoulder-fired RPG (Rocket-Propelled Grenade) is a heavy weapon usually reserved for destroying hostile vehicles such as the M1 Abrams tank and Apache helicopter.
The RPG is extremely powerful, but ammo is scarce relative to the lighter weapons in the game. Thus, the player is forced to conserve his ammo, saving rockets for more serious encounters. The RPG has the option of firing with or without a laser guidance system, detailed below. Like other explosives, the RPG will detonate other nearby explosives on impact, so it is recommended that the user keep aware of nearby laser tripmines and explosive barrels.
The RPG has a reserve of 5 rockets in Black Mesa [1].
Primary Function
Fire the rocket. The RPG cannot be holstered nor reloaded until the rocket is destroyed [2].
Secondary Function
Enable/Disable the laser guidance system.
If the laser system is enabled, a red dot appears at the crosshair target. When fired, the rocket will attempt to follow the dot as it closes in. This is ideal for tracking mobile targets.
If the laser system is disabled, no red dot appears at the crosshair. When fired, the rocket will continue in a straight path in the direction the launcher was pointed at the time. This is ideal for shooting around a corner when the player cannot be exposed for long.
Trivia
- The RPG is one of a selection of weapons in Half-Life and Black Mesa that can be fired while underwater.
- Because of a glitch in the original Half-Life's RPG, its laser could be used to guide rockets fired from enemy vehicles. This will not be possible in Black Mesa. [3]
